Transaction 75701520f9f6f4ecd7628f36c1d9ff5fd8381751a4715757efe359581b6c2b7f
1 Input
1 Output
-
75701520f9f6f4ecd7628f36c1d9ff5fd8381751a4715757efe359581b6c2b7f:0
- value
- 751125
- script pubkey
- OP_0 OP_PUSHBYTES_20 2100d95d3a802127e62f89ffd1b34ac313fe9626
- address
- bc1qyyqdjhf6sqsj0e3038larv62cvfla93xy3y7gg